Understanding the Core Mechanics of Dragon Tiger
At its essence, dragontiger is a head-to-head card comparison game. A single card is dealt to both the Dragon and the Tiger sides, and the player simply bets on which card will be higher. Card values are straightforward, with Ace being the highest and 2 being the lowest. The suit of the card holds no significance; only the numerical value matters. If the Dragon and Tiger cards have the same value, it results in a ‘Tie’ and pays out at predetermined odds, typically 8:1 or 10:1, depending on the casino. The simplicity extends to the betting options themselves – you wager on the Dragon, the Tiger, or a Tie. This streamlined mechanic is a major draw for players who prefer a direct and uncomplicated gaming experience.
The Role of the Dealer and Card Dealing Process
The entire process is overseen by a dealer, who ensures fairness and manages the betting process. Typically, the dealer uses a standard 52-card deck, shuffling it thoroughly before each round. The first card dealt goes to the Dragon position, and the second goes to the Tiger. This sequential dealing method helps to maintain transparency and prevent any perceived manipulation. The dealer then announces the card values, and winning bets are paid out accordingly. In modern online versions, a Random Number Generator (RNG) simulates the dealing process to ensure unbiased and random outcomes. Many live casino versions feature a real-life dealer streamed directly to the player’s screen, enhancing the immersive experience.
| Outcome | Payout |
|---|---|
| Dragon Wins | 1:1 |
| Tiger Wins | 1:1 |
| Tie | 8:1 or 10:1 |
Understanding the payout structure is critical for any player. Winning bets on Dragon or Tiger typically offer a 1:1 payout, meaning you receive your original stake back plus an equal amount in winnings. However, the 'Tie' bet, while less frequent, offers significantly higher payouts, making it an attractive option for those seeking a larger reward, despite the lower probability of success.

Exploring Different Betting Variations in Dragontiger
Beyond the basic Dragon, Tiger, and Tie bets, some casinos offer variations that add another layer of complexity and potential reward. Perfect Pair bets, for example, pay out if the Dragon and Tiger cards form a pair (e.g., two Queens). These bets typically offer significantly higher payouts, but their probability of success is considerably lower. Another variation is the Colored Pair bet, which pays out if the Dragon and Tiger cards are of the same rank and also share the same color (both red or both black). Understanding these variations and their associated odds is crucial for making informed betting decisions. Be aware that the house edge can vary between these bets, so it's important to choose wisely based on your risk tolerance and betting strategy.
Understanding the House Edge and Payout Percentages
The house edge represents the casino’s advantage in any given game. In dragontiger, the house edge is relatively low, particularly on the Dragon and Tiger bets, typically around 2.11%. However, the house edge on the 'Tie' bet is significantly higher, often exceeding 12%, making it a less favorable option in the long run. Payout percentages are directly related to the house edge. A higher payout percentage means a lower house edge, and vice versa. When choosing a dragontiger game, it's advisable to research the payout percentages offered by different casinos and select those with the most favorable terms. Understanding these metrics can help you maximize your potential winnings and minimize your overall risk.
